WebStand-up paddleboarding (aka SUP) is one of the most popular water sports in San Diego. A mixture of perfect temps, smooth waves, and accessibility of equipment make for ideal conditions to stand up and glide around the waters of America's Finest City (and county). Grab your surfboard and head to one of these coastal towns known for great surfing, a welcoming beachside … cryptograpghy community testingWebJan 12, 2024 · El Paredon, Guatemala is the perfect example of a surf town on the rise. Still tiny and home to fishermen and salt farmers, the surf scene is bringing opportunity here. Miles of black sand beach face south and these swells come straight up from Antarctica.
